Rena makes a one-pan chicken dinner (with a secret ingredient!) that’s easy enough for weeknights, yet special enough for Rosh Hashana.
Get the recipe:
4–6 chicken thighs (bone-in, skin-on)
2 sweet potatoes, peeled and cut into wedges
5 carrots, peeled and cut into chunks
¼ cup cornstarch
Salt & black pepper
